The Finisar FWLF1621P2T59 transceiver module provides 2Gbps CWDM connectivity over single-mode fiber using a duplex LC connector. It fits into SFP slots on network devices, delivering a focused wavelength at 1591nm that supports Fibre Channel environments. This module bridges devices in storage networks, ensuring efficient data flow without unnecessary complexity. |

This Finisar transceiver module is built for transmitting data at 2Gbps over single-mode fiber using coarse wavelength division multiplexing (CWDM) at 1591nm. It's commonly used in Fibre Channel storage area networks where reliable, high-speed data transfer is essential. Network engineers and storage administrators often find it useful for linking switches, servers, and storage arrays with minimal signal loss. Key Features
This module is typically deployed in data centers where consistent, error-free fiber connections are critical. It plays a key role in maintaining smooth communication between storage components and networking gear, improving overall system reliability. |
